Overview:

The Transformative Promise of the Indian Constitution and Contemporary Challenges by Pradeep Kulshrestha offers a profound exploration of the Constitution as a living, evolving document shaped by India?s socio-political realities. The book traces how constitutional ideals justice, liberty, equality, and fraternity have been interpreted, expanded, and sometimes tested through landmark judgments, policy shifts, and emerging societal issues. It provides a balanced narrative that connects historical foundations with present-day constitutional dilemmas, helping readers understand how constitutionalism functions in a rapidly changing nation.

Key Features

  • In-depth analysis of constitutional evolution with emphasis on how contemporary political, social, and technological shifts influence constitutional interpretation.
  • Discussion of major Supreme Court decisions that illustrate the dynamic nature of fundamental rights, federalism, and separation of powers.
  • Dedicated chapters on modern challenges such as digital privacy, civil liberties, environmental governance, socio-economic rights, and democratic accountability.
  • Comparative perspectives highlighting how India?s constitutional responses align with or diverge from global constitutional practices.
  • Clear, accessible writing suitable for both academic study and practical understanding, supported by structured arguments and real-world examples.

This book is ideal for law students, competitive exam aspirants, legal researchers, practitioners, academicians, and policy enthusiasts who seek a deeper appreciation of India?s constitutional landscape.
